Some folks offered to let me take some scrap metal to cash in. I looked at the piles and it seemed some of the stuff was aluminum and variuos junk. Could someone let me know if they take any metals at the scrapyard. Also I needed to find out if A 5x8 utility trailer has a title? I thought I had one but cant find it. Thanks in advance Bruce

Most if not all scrap yards take all metals, but you have to clean it up & separate the aluminum & steel or the price goes way down & most wont accept it. As for the trailer, anything that has to be registered, has a title somewhere. You can claim it as a homemade trailer & get one though.

Actually, any trailer under 2,500 lbs. does not require a title.  It does need to be registered and tagged to use on the roadways.
